ntupdate = 18:56, 25 September 2008 (UTC)Karl Leon Hawley (born on
6 December 1981 inWalsall , West Midlands) is an English professional footballer, currently with Preston North End, who plays as astriker . Hawley has represented England C.Hawley started his career for his hometown team Walsall but only played one league game. While at the
Bescot Stadium he also spent loan spells at Raith Rovers and Hereford United.After his release by Walsall in 2004, Hawley joined Southern League side Hednesford Town, but only made one start for the Pitmen, playing in a league game against Hinckley United. He was again released towards the end of the 2003–04 season. Hawley joined the then Conference team Carlisle United in the summer of 2004 and played a part in their return to
the Football League . He was theLeague Two top scorer in the 2005-2006 season, forming a successful partnership withMichael Bridges as Carlisle achieved a second successive promotion to League One. Hawley was voted League Two Fans' Player of the Year and was part of the League Two Team of the Year. [cite news
